Transaction 014933343f07785ec680de3db17a5ea6e7449ca2d17b569fb49f6e89b78eee12

block
576b454282def1f6e600bee69dea7fd2b94cbb7cc9f57262bcd999c62f009598

1 Input

2 Outputs